The IKL (Institute for Education in the Arts) Atelierkollektiv (Studio-Collective) is a group of students who autonomously organize a space for artistic work. The members work in diverse fields and express themselves in a variety of forms. They regularly meet to share ideas and plan events. See our works in the very space they are created. The topic of this year’s exhibition by the Atelierkollektiv is “Vernetzung” – because the Rundgang is for making new connections, and so do we as an artists’ collective!
In a time of individualism, when everyone is fending for themselves, we try to create a space for community, where we can exchange ideas and help each other. We each bring a set of very different skills and resources to the table and strive to connect within our artistic work as well as the results from it. The art we create is as diverse as our approaches and techniques, from painting to ceramics, from installations to performance, from textile art to graphic design.
As aspiring art educators, it is always important to us to present and practice art as something open, connecting, and exciting. To weave a web…
